Excellent copper turned parts factory: Choosing the right copper parts manufacturer does not solely depend on budget or pricing. It requires a supplier with proven expertise in control over strict tolerances, inventory, and product repeatability. In engineered systems, inconsistent copper parts can lead to performance failures and prolonged rework. Therefore, you have to have a partner who knows material behaviour and forming limits. The selection of copper alloy, wall thickness, and grain direction should comply with your design specifications. In addition, the forming, brazing, and CNC processes ought to be accurately handled. This guide highlights the fundamental considerations to make in choosing a suitable copper parts manufacturing firm. Recycling and Reusing Material: Implementing a recycling and reuse strategy for scrap materials can reduce costs. Recycling metal chips and reusing material where possible can lead to significant savings, especially in high-volume production. The main frame of the high-rigidity machine tool is equipped with a slider balance device, a machine foot shock absorber and an emergency braking device, which not only ensures the safety of stamping technicians, but also ensures the accuracy of machine production and protects the service life of the punch and mold; it also It is equipped with a full set of auxiliary supporting devices, such as commonly used high-precision gap feeding devices, balancing devices, vibration reduction and noise reduction devices, to ensure its stamping performance. It has extremely high stamping accuracy and feeding accuracy. The stamping accuracy of each high-speed punch press can reach the accuracy standard, and the feeding accuracy can reach ±0.01~0.03mm, which is beneficial to improving the positioning accuracy of the work steps and reducing damage to equipment or molds caused by inaccurate feeding.
At present, our company has introduced 3 sets of Sei bu slow wire cutting machines, whose processing accuracy is within 0.002MM. They are mainly used to process various precision, small and complex terminals, shrapnel, and bracket molds. They mainly control product accuracy while also improving cutting, Speed, the cutting speed can reach 220mm/min. Fortuna has 8 sets of grinders, among which the machining accuracy can reach within 0.002mm. It is capable of precision grinding of various materials and is easy to operate. It can not only complete the processing of conventional parts such as shafts and ball shaft couplings, and can also complete the processing of parts with various complex shapes. After we receive the customer’s drawings, professional engineers will conduct DFM analysis of the product. Design feasibility analysis: Evaluate the feasibility of the mold design, including mold materials, structure and processing technology. By analyzing whether the mold design meets the existing technical conditions and process capabilities, determine its feasibility and provide suggestions for improvement. Manufacturability analysis: Conduct multi-dimensional analysis on the drawings provided by customers to provide customers with a variety of achievable, cost-reducing and efficiency-increasing stamping solutions while ensuring the functional structure of the product.

Paying attention to these details can enhance the machining process and result in superior products. Hole and Slot Design – Holes and slots are common features in CNC machined parts. Optimal hole sizes and depths vary depending on the material and intended function. Generally, avoiding extremely deep or very small holes can prevent issues during machining. When designing slots, consider the width, depth, and spacing. Properly designed slots can enhance the part’s functionality and make machining more straightforward. Avoiding overly narrow or deep slots can reduce the risk of tool breakage and ensure smooth machining.
